Pray for the nation, Buni urges Nigerians 

The Yobe state governor, Mai Mala Buni, has urged the people of the state to use the Eid-el-Kabir occasion to pray for the state and country.

The governor, in his Sallah message to the people on Monday  said, “the peace, security and prosperity of the country is paramount to every citizen.

“We should therefore intensify prayers for our leaders to be guided aright for increased peace, security, and prosperity of our dear country.”

He urged the people to promote the virtues of peaceful coexistence, love, and sacrifice being lessons of the Eid.

“These virtues should go beyond the Sallah season for us to build a peaceful, strong, and united country,” Buni said.

The governor commended the security agencies for their commitment to ensuring peace reigns across the state.

He also appreciated the people for their resilience in rebuilding their communities and recovering their means of livelihood.

“As the rainy season commences, we should engage in agriculture to produce our food needs. 

“Our administration would soon launch a massive agricultural revolution to make agriculture attractive, productive, and profitable to meet our food requirement and export others for economic development,” he said.
